Ethiopian Opal in Full Spectrum: A Painting by Nature

Ethiopian opals are natural wonders, with vivid color patterns that seem to have been hand-painted by the soil. The remarkable interior colors of these opals, which are primarily from the Welo region, range from cold greens and electric blues to flaming reds and glowing oranges. Ethiopian opal stone is hydrophane, or water-absorbing, in contrast to other opals, which can momentarily change their transparency and increase their brilliance. Each piece is unique due to the stone's kaleidoscopic patterns, which stand for imagination, spontaneity, and emotional release.
